易语言实现Python调用,源码实例教程
需积分: 50 17 浏览量
更新于2024-11-24
收藏 19KB ZIP 举报
资源摘要信息:"易语言调用Python源码例程-易语言"
易语言是一种中文编程语言,它以其简洁明了的中文语法和强大的功能支持,吸引了许多编程初学者和爱好者。它提供了大量的内置功能和模块,方便用户快速开发应用程序。Python是一种广泛使用的高级编程语言,以其简洁易读的代码和强大的标准库而著称。易语言与Python的结合,可以实现快速开发的同时利用Python丰富的第三方库资源。
易语言调用Python源码的例程展示了如何在易语言中嵌入和执行Python代码。这一功能允许易语言开发者利用Python的库和功能来扩展易语言应用的边界。在这个例程中,我们将会看到如何在易语言环境下运行Python脚本,并且如何将易语言的数据与Python脚本进行交互。
例程包含以下几个重要知识点:
1. 易语言与Python交互的基础:了解易语言如何与Python代码进行交互,包括调用Python解释器、传递参数、执行Python脚本以及获取脚本执行结果。
2. Python环境配置:在易语言中调用Python之前,需要确保系统中已安装Python环境,并且需要配置好Python解释器的路径,以便易语言能够正确找到并调用Python解释器。
3. 调用Python脚本的方法:易语言提供了调用外部程序的命令,通过这些命令可以加载并执行Python脚本。例如,使用“运行”命令或者“Shell调用”命令可以实现这一功能。
4. 数据交互:易语言和Python之间的数据交互是通过临时文件、标准输入输出或命令行参数等方式实现的。了解如何在这两种语言间传递数据是使用这个功能的关键。
5. 示例脚本分析:在易语言中调用Python脚本的例程通常包含几个部分,包括易语言的主程序、用于调用Python代码的代码片段以及Python脚本本身。在本例程中,我们将会看到如何实现一个简单的Python API调用,并分析这些组件是如何协同工作的。
6. Web API的调用:例程中的Web_API.py文件可能用于演示如何使用Python编写并调用Web API。这表明易语言通过Python可以轻松地实现网络编程功能,这对于需要网络交互的应用程序来说非常重要。
7. 错误处理:在易语言和Python交互的过程中,错误处理是不可或缺的一环。正确地处理可能出现的错误,例如Python解释器未找到、执行脚本出错等,是保证程序稳定运行的关键。
例程中包含的文件列表是:
- E_Python.e:可能是一个易语言编写的脚本,用于展示如何在易语言中嵌入Python代码。
- Example.e:一个易语言的示例程序文件。
- Web_API.py:一个Python脚本,可能用于演示如何编写Web API调用。
- [example2]POST.py:另一个Python脚本示例,可能用于演示POST请求等网络操作。
- [example1]Python_running_API.py:这个文件名暗示这是一个用于运行或调用Python API的脚本。
- E_Python.ec:可能是易语言编写的配置文件或者字典文件,用于存储与Python交互时所需的配置信息。
通过以上例程和文件列表的分析,我们可以看到易语言与Python结合的强大功能,以及在实际开发中可能遇到的各种情况。这为希望在易语言中充分利用Python生态系统的开发者提供了一个很好的起点。
537 浏览量
581 浏览量
428 浏览量
2021-06-13 上传
184 浏览量
428 浏览量
2021-06-13 上传
208 浏览量